The Vertiglide dispatch simulator runs nightly against recorded traffic from the Harrowgate tower model. If runs exceed 45 minutes, check the hall-call queue replay — it deadlocks when car count is misconfigured. Never edit scenario files in place; copy to a draft first. Config schema, known failure modes, and restart steps are documented on the page below.

wiki page, tahaf-tajog: https://jira.ordindyn.corp/pipeline

Welcome aboard! This PR adds idempotency keys to payment retries in the Tillwick gateway. Short version: every retry now carries the original attempt's key, so double-charges from flaky networks should disappear. Keys live in the `retry_ledger` table with a TTL, and duplicates get a cached response instead of a new charge. Retry pacing and key expiry are controlled by the constants below.

tuning constants:
QUOTAS = {
    "julwyn": 448,
    "belix": 11,
}

Welcome, plugin authors. The QueueScale autoscaler watches queue depth on the internal Flowline broker and calls your plugin to decide scaling actions. Your plugin receives depth samples every ten seconds and must respond within two seconds, or QueueScale falls back to its default policy. During development you will run against the Flowline sandbox, which mirrors production metrics with a five-minute delay. Authentication to the sandbox uses a shared development key, rotated monthly. The current sandbox key is provided below.

service key, bafop-kafop: qvz2-us

MANAGEMENT MEETING MINUTES — for the Incoming Director

Attendees: Prue, Saul, Imka.

Agreed to move logistics from Dunmore Carriage to Veltrix Freight from next quarter. Dunmore's missed-window rate was the deciding factor. Veltrix trial on the Ashgrove route went cleanly. Transition plan owed by Saul in two weeks. The confidential note below explains the wider thinking.

board note of kagep-yahig: Only 9 of the 120 pilot accounts renewed Quenix, so a churn review is set for April 1.